What are outdoor bottles made of?

  • Outdoor bottles are typically made from materials such as stainless steel, aluminum, and BPA-free plastic. Stainless steel is popular for its durability and insulation properties, while aluminum is lightweight and often used for on-the-go hydration. BPA-free plastic options are also available for those seeking a lighter alternative.

How do outdoor bottles keep drinks cold?

  • Many outdoor bottles utilize double-wall vacuum insulation, which creates an airless space between the inner and outer walls to minimize heat transfer. This technology helps maintain the temperature of your beverages, keeping cold drinks chilled for hours and hot drinks warm. The effectiveness can vary based on the bottle's design and material.

What size outdoor bottle should I choose?

  • The size of the outdoor bottle you choose depends on your hydration needs and the duration of your activities. Smaller bottles (around 18-24 ounces) are great for short hikes or daily use, while larger options (32 ounces and above) are ideal for longer excursions. Consider your carrying capacity and how much water you typically consume during your adventures.

What features should I look for in an outdoor bottle?

  • When selecting an outdoor bottle, consider features such as insulation type, material durability, lid design, and size. Look for leak-proof seals, wide mouths for easy filling and cleaning, and lightweight options for portability. Additional features like built-in straws or handles can also enhance convenience during outdoor activities.
